Key Responsibilities:
Underwriting & Financial Analysis:
Assist in underwriting various commercial real estate asset classes, including office, hotel, multifamily, retail, and specialty properties.
Review profit and loss statements, rent rolls, and other financial data to help assess property performance.
Support cash flow analyses, including discounted cash flow (DCF) modeling, and run basic sensitivity and scenario tests.
Market Research:
Conduct market research to support underwriting assumptions, including gathering data on comparable sales, rent levels, and occupancy rates.
Stay informed on U.S. commercial real estate market trends to provide insights to the team.
Investment Memorandum Preparation:
Contribute to the preparation of investment memorandums by compiling underwriting results and market data into presentations.
Provide initial observations and recommendations on potential investment opportunities.
Collaboration & Communication:
Work closely with senior analysts and other team members to ensure timely and accurate underwriting support.
Communicate effectively with internal teams and U.S.-based clients to address questions and gather necessary information.
